Display device with optical sensor included and image reading method employing same
Abstract:
Provided is a display device with photosensors that can achieve a scanner function without increasing the memory capacity for images. A display device with photosensors includes a visible light source and an invisible light source. The display device with photosensors further includes: a first photosensor that detects the amount of received light in a pixel region when the invisible light source is on; a second optical sensor that detects the amount of received light in the pixel region when the invisible light source is off; and a third photosensor that detects the amount of received light reflected from an object to be scanned, causing only display pixels respectively nearest to the third photosensors within a prescribed range in the pixel region to be in a display state, and causing other pixels in the prescribed range to be in a non-display state. Data obtained from the third photosensor is stored in a memory (205) including a region (205a) that stores therein first reference data obtained when the invisible light source is on, and a region (205b) that stores therein second reference data obtained when the invisible light source is off.
